Why we’re doing this

One of the biggest barriers to supplier decarbonisation isn’t ambition, it’s inconsistency.

Suppliers receive different requests from every customer, buyers repeatedly answer the same questions, and everyone spends time reinventing approaches that already exist elsewhere.

The Scope 3 Value Exchange Summit is designed to reduce that friction by creating more consistent guidance, stronger collaboration and more direct conversations between buyers and suppliers.

The result is less confusion, faster action and better commercial outcomes for everyone involved.
